Choose Between a Resort Island and a Local Island
One of the first decisions to make when planning a Maldives vacation is whether you want to stay at a private resort or on a local island.
Private Resort Islands
Private resort islands are ideal for travelers who want privacy, luxury, premium facilities, beautiful beaches, and a relaxing vacation experience. Many resorts operate on their own islands and provide restaurants, spas, water activities, swimming pools, and excursions.
Local Islands
Local islands offer a more affordable way to experience the Maldives. Guesthouses, local restaurants, beaches, and excursion operators allow travelers to experience more of everyday Maldivian life.
Local islands can be especially attractive to budget-conscious travelers and visitors who want more interaction with local communities.

How to Get Around the Maldives
Speedboats
Speedboats are commonly used to transfer visitors between Malé and nearby islands. They can be a convenient option for resorts located relatively close to the capital.
Seaplanes
Seaplanes connect Malé with some resorts located farther away. The journey can also provide spectacular aerial views of the islands and atolls.
Domestic Flights
Some destinations require a domestic flight followed by a speedboat transfer. Your resort should provide the complete transfer information after booking.
Walking
On many small resort and local islands, walking is the simplest way to explore the surroundings.
Maldives Food You Should Try
Maldivian cuisine is influenced by the country's location in the Indian Ocean and commonly features fish, coconut, rice, spices, and tropical ingredients.
- Mas huni
- Garudhiya
- Fish curry
- Fihunu mas
- Gulha
- Bis keemiya
- Rihaakuru
- Coconut-based dishes
- Fresh seafood
- Tropical fruits
Resort restaurants also offer international cuisine, so visitors can enjoy both local dishes and familiar meals during their stay.

Maldives Dress Code and Local Customs
Resort islands generally have relaxed clothing policies around beaches and pools, although restaurants may have their own dress requirements.
When visiting local islands, travelers should respect Maldivian culture and dress more modestly in public areas. Rules regarding swimwear and other activities can vary by location, so check local guidance before visiting.
The Maldives is a Muslim-majority country, and respecting local customs is an important part of responsible travel.

Common Maldives Travel Mistakes to Avoid
Ignoring Transfer Costs
A resort may appear affordable until transfer fees are added. Always check the complete cost of reaching the island.
Choosing a Resort Only for Its Photos
Beautiful photographs do not tell the entire story. Check the beach, reef, dining, facilities, location, and recent guest information before booking.
Not Researching the House Reef
If snorkeling is important to you, investigate whether the resort has a good house reef and how easily guests can access it.
Overplanning Activities
The Maldives is also about relaxation. Leave enough free time to enjoy the beach, lagoon, villa, and resort facilities.
Forgetting About Weather
Tropical weather can change quickly. Keep your plans flexible and check forecasts before booking outdoor excursions.

Responsible Travel in the Maldives
The Maldives' natural environment is an important part of its appeal. Travelers can help protect it by avoiding damage to coral reefs, following marine-life guidelines, reducing unnecessary plastic use, and respecting wildlife.
Choose responsible snorkeling and diving practices, never touch or stand on coral, and follow instructions from qualified guides.
